Biography
Dr. Yuanchen Zeng is a new faculty member in the Department of Civil and Environmental Engineering at the University of Illinois Urbana-Champaign. His research spans the inspection, monitoring, assessment, and maintenance of transportation infrastructure and vehicles through the development and integration of intelligent sensing, signal processing, modal analysis, data fusion, machine learning, digital twin, and predictive maintenance technologies.
Dr. Zeng has over ten years of research experience in railway infrastructure and rolling stock. Before joining Illinois, he served as a Postdoctoral Researcher at Delft University of Technology, where he contributed to several major research projects sponsored by the European Commission, government ministries, and ProRail. He also contributed to graduate courses on vehicle-track dynamics and structural health monitoring and supervised undergraduate, master's, and Ph.D. students.
Dr. Zeng received his Ph.D. in Railway Engineering from Delft University of Technology in 2023, where his dissertation was recognized by the European Railway Research Advisory Council (ERRAC). He also holds a Ph.D. in Vehicle Operation Engineering from Southwest Jiaotong University, where his research on wheel life-cycle management has been deployed in high-speed train applications since 2019.
Dr. Zeng has authored over 20 journal publications. He received the Young Researcher Award at the Transport Research Arena (TRA) 2026, organized by the European Commission. He serves as a guest editor, scientific committee member, and reviewer for several leading journals and international conferences.
